Skip to content

fcneves81/jokenpo_python

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

2 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

PEDRA PAPEL E TESOURA



Informações sobre o aplicativo

Linguagem utilizada:

Python
ConsoleApp

Bibiliotecas utilizadas:

Bibliotecas que são padrão do Python estão marcadas com um sinal de ✔️

Bibliotecas que requerem instalação estão marcadas com um sinal de ❗ e ao clicar no nome da biblioteca você será redirecionado(a) à documentação da mesma.

✔️ Random
✔️ Time
❗    Pygame

Estrutura do aplicativo:

O arquivo main.py é o responsável por rodar a aplicação.

Ele chama o arquivo languages.py que contém uma lista dos idiomas suportados atualmente:

  • Inglês (EUA)
  • Português (Brasil)
  • Alemão (Alemanha, sendo que o arquivo está regionalizado com a versão alemã do jogo: Schinick, Schnack, Schnuck, não sendo apenas uma tradução)

Para adicionar um novo idioma, basta incluí-lo na lista de idiomas, criar a opção de chamada correspondente ao seu índice nas opções do comando match e criar o arquivo correspondente, fazendo claro a devida importação do mesmo.

O jogo tem um menu principal, onde o jogador pode escolher entre as opções Pedra, Papel, Tesoura, Como jogar ou Sair, sendo que todas as ações são feitas através dos números do teclado.


About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ages